Stream Chat
undefined
| Detail | Value |
|---|---|
| Category | Communication |
| Base URL | https://chat.stream-io-api.com |
| Authentication | API Key (Query) |
| Endpoints | 6 |
| Connector key | stream-chat |
Using Stream Chat in a workflow
- Go to Connections and click New Connection.
- Pick Stream Chat from the marketplace.
- Enter your credentials (see Authentication above for what's expected).
- In a workflow, drop an API Call node and select this connection.
- Pick the operation you need from the Operation dropdown — the full list is below.
